Rajasthan Police Constable: Age Limit

For Driver Posts: –
  • Minimum Age: 18 Years (01-01-2008)
  • Max. Age for Male: 26 Years (02-01-1999)
  • Max. Age for Female: 31 Years (02-02-1994)

For Other Posts: –

  • Minimum Age: 18 Years (01-01-2008)
  • Max. Age for Male: 23 Years (02-01-2002)
  • Max. Age for Female: 28 Years (02-02-1997)

Rajasthan Police Constable: Physical Standard Test (PST)

Male Female
Height (in cm) 168 cm 152 cm
Chest (Un-expanded / Expanded) 81 cm / 86 cm N/A
Weight N/A 47.5 kg

Rajasthan Police Constable: Physical Efficiency Test (PET)

Category Race Distance
Male Candidates 5 Km in 25 Minutes.
Female Candidates 5 Km in 35 Minutes.

How to Download Your Rajasthan Police PET/PST Admit Card

Downloading your admit card is a simple, mandatory step. Follow these steps carefully to ensure you have your hall ticket printed and ready:

  1. Visit the Official Portal: Go to the official website of the Rajasthan Police: police.rajasthan.gov.in or the recruitment portal recruitment2.rajasthan.gov.in.
  2. Navigate to the Admit Card Section: Look for the section labelled “Recruitments and Results” or a direct link for the “Constable Recruitment 2025 PET/PST Admit Card.”
  3. Login: You will be redirected to a login page. Enter your required credentials, which typically include:
    • Application ID or Registration Number
    • Date of Birth (D.O.B)
    • Captcha Code (as displayed on the screen)
  4. Download and Print: After logging in, your Rajasthan Police Constable PET/PST Admit Card will appear. Download the PDF and take a clear printout.

Mandatory Documents to Carry

Candidates must bring the following documents to the exam centre:

  • Printed copy of Rajasthan Police PET Admit Card
  • One Valid Photo ID Proof (Original): Aadhaar Card /Voter ID / PAN Card / Driving License, or Passport.
  • Two recent passport-size photographs.
  • Sports / Running shoes and track suit (as required for PET).
  • Any other document mentioned explicitly in the instructions on your admit card.
